Alternatives to beds?
So my piece of garbage Ikea bed just broke(the main support beam snapped in two, after it had already broken in a couple of other places) so for the time being I'm doing the mattress on the floor thing.
I am looking into a new bed, but I wonder if anyone has any good suggestions on alternatives to beds? I used a Japanese futon for 6 months while I was living there, but would have no idea how I could get one shipped to me in Germany. Is there anyone else that that doesn't have a proper "bed" per se? What do you use and how do you like it? |

Inflatable beds are okay, but the one I had smelt rubbery, it had a built-in pillow in the form of a low bump at one end which annoyed me because I like to put my arm under the pillow, and it could be a bit cold sometimes. Your body doesn't warm the air in the same way it warms a mattress and you might have to put a blanket under the bottom sheet. I think futons are a good idea, but I'd invest in the best mattress for it that I could. |
